Power BI怎么接入dbf文件数据?
dbf文件是一种比较经典(就是说很老的意思咯)的数据库文件,以前用FoxPro开发程序的老朋友应该很熟悉,有兴趣了解的新朋友也可以百度知道一下:
也可能因为实在太经典,现在Power BI没有提供直接的连接方式,但毕竟还是有人用的,这不,群里就有朋友问了:
当然,我也很久没接触过dbf文件了,但是,我觉得应该是没有问题的——经验总是使我对很多未知的情况有信心,而很多时候,信心真的很重要!——所以,我决定百度一下(遇到问题多百度还是能学到不少东西的,注意不要被太多的广告忽悠住就是了,学会从沙堆里淘金子也是一项重要的能力),原来早就有人问过:
打开第一个,竟然是大神高飞回答的:
按照高飞回答的方法,打开Power BI新建空查询:
打开高级编辑器,并复制下方代码,注意修改其中的文件路径和文件名:
let
Source = OleDb.DataSource("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=E:\hugo\PBI\;extended properties=dBASE IV", [Query="select * from [eth_rainst.dbf]"])
in
Source
完成后确定,但还没完,接下来是上面回答里没说的一点内容:
1、点击编辑凭据
2、在弹出的对话框里选择默认或自定义,字符串属性中留空(如果有密码的选数据库后输用户名密码),然后单击连接按钮:
大功告成,且上面的凭据设置一次后不需要再进行设置:
为方便大家练习加强记忆,本案例中用到的dbf文件可通过文末说明方法下载哦。
赞 (0)